Output efbd1369e4a76751852fbbc8e978fee1998214cc1ef733057ca1bc20aa1624c1:1

value
26252056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a33162e5ee9ac738d4af34747f4d602266856fd2 OP_EQUAL
address
3GZuEEWvoyrrDuS5AyNsx5y3pAqhPgGa79
transaction
efbd1369e4a76751852fbbc8e978fee1998214cc1ef733057ca1bc20aa1624c1
spent
true